Hacker News

747 și agenți de codificare

Comentarii

15 min read Via carlkolon.com

Mewayz Team

Editorial Team

Hacker News

Ce ne poate învăța un Jumbo Jet de 60 de ani despre viitorul codării AI

În 1968, Boeing a lansat primul 747 din cea mai mare clădire construită vreodată în funcție de suprafața podelei - o fabrică din Everett, Washington, atât de vastă încât odată s-au format nori de ploaie în interiorul acesteia. Aeronava în sine era la fel de îndrăzneață: șase milioane de piese, 171 de mile de cabluri și o anvergură mai mare decât primul zbor al fraților Wright era lung. A fost, din toate punctele de vedere, cea mai complexă mașină produsă vreodată în serie. Aproape șase decenii mai târziu, ingineria software-ului se confruntă cu propriul său moment 747. Agenții de codare – sisteme AI autonome care pot scrie, depana, testa și implementa cod cu o supraveghere umană minimă – reprezintă un salt în complexitate și ambiție care oglindește revoluția jumbo jet. Și lecțiile din acea primă eră a ingineriei radicale sunt mai relevante ca niciodată.

Șase milioane de părți și șase milioane de linii de cod

Boeing 747 nu doar a extins designul aeronavelor existente. Era nevoie de procese de producție complet noi, științe noi ale materialelor, noi cadre de asigurare a calității și o forță de muncă care trebuia să învețe cum să se coordoneze la un nivel de complexitate pe care nimeni nu l-a încercat înainte. Joe Sutter, inginer-șef, a descris în mod celebru proiectul ca „construirea unei catedrale în timp ce o zboară”. Echipa abia aștepta perfecțiunea – trebuia să livreze, să repete și să remedieze problemele în timp real, păstrând în același timp un program de producție neiertător.

Agenții moderni de codare se confruntă cu o provocare uimitor de similară. Un instrument precum Claude, Cursor sau Devin nu completează doar automat o linie de cod. Raționează cu privire la arhitectură, navighează în arbori de dependență, scrie teste, gestionează cazurile marginale și coordonează modificările în zeci de fișiere simultan. Suprafața de defecțiune este enormă - la fel ca sistemele hidraulice ale lui 747, unde o singură linie greșită ar putea cădea în cascadă în catastrofă. Inginerii care construiesc acești agenți nu scriu doar software. Ei construiesc sisteme care construiesc sisteme, o problemă recursivă de complexitate care i-ar fi dat coșmaruri lui Joe Sutter.

La Mewayz, am simțit această complexitate direct. Platforma noastră cuprinde 207 module — de la CRM și facturare la HR, managementul flotei și analiză — fiecare cu propria logică, modele de date și puncte de integrare. Când am început să integrăm dezvoltarea asistată de AI în fluxul nostru de lucru, am aflat rapid că puterea agentului era direct proporțională cu înțelegerea acestuia asupra întregului sistem, nu doar cu fișierul pe care îl edita. Sună cunoscut? Sistemul de management al zborului lui 747 a funcționat în același mod: fiecare subsistem trebuia să își înțeleagă relația cu întregul.

The Crew Resource Management Parallel

După o serie de accidente din anii 1970 și 1980, industria aviației a dezvoltat Crew Resource Management (CRM) – un cadru care a redefinit modul în care piloții, copiloții și inginerii de zbor comunică, delegă și împart autoritatea de luare a deciziilor. Perspectiva a fost profundă: problema nu era piloții răi. A fost o coordonare proastă. Un căpitan strălucit care a ignorat avertismentul primului său ofițer era mai periculos decât un echipaj mediocru care comunica bine.

Agenții de codare forțează industria software-ului să se aplice propriei calcule CRM. Întrebarea nu mai este „cât de bun este AI la scrierea codului?” ci mai degrabă „cât de bine se coordonează oamenii și agenții?” Cei mai productivi dezvoltatori care folosesc agenți de codare nu sunt cei care predau proiecte întregi și pleacă. Ei sunt cei care tratează agentul ca pe un copilot calificat — oferind context, revizuind rezultate, prinde punctele moarte și știu când să preia controlul manual.

De aceea, narațiunea „agentul înlocuiește dezvoltatorul” ratează complet ideea. 747 nu i-a înlocuit pe piloți. Acesta a făcut ca rolul pilotului să fie mai strategic, mai orientat spre sisteme și, în cele din urmă, mai critic. Căpitanul unui 747 gestionează automatizarea, monitorizează sistemele și intervine atunci când se întâmplă un neașteptat. Exact asta face un dezvoltator senior cu un agent de codare în 2026.

Liste de verificare preflight și inginerie promptă

Una dintre cele mai durabile contribuții ale aviației la fiabilitatea umană este lista de verificare. După prăbușirea în 1935 a modelului Boeing 299 – un prototip atât de complex încât pilotul de testare majorul Ployer Peter Hill a uitat pur și simplu un pas critic – inginerii au dezvoltat lista de verificare înainte de zbor. Nu a fost o cârjă pentru piloții incompetenți. A fost o recunoaștere a faptului că cunoașterea umană are limite și că sistemele complexe necesită protocoale structurate.

Inginerie promptă pentru agenții de codificare este lista de verificare preflight a lumii software. Dezvoltatorii care obțin cele mai bune rezultate de la agenții AI nu scriu instrucțiuni vagi precum „construiește-mi un tablou de bord”. Ele oferă context structurat: stiva tehnologică, convențiile de codare, cazurile marginale de urmărit, fișierele care ar trebui și nu ar trebui modificate. Ei scriu fișiere CLAUDE.md și solicitări de sistem cu aceeași rigoare pe care o aplică un pilot într-un briefing înainte de plecare.

Cea mai periculoasă presupunere atât în domeniul aviației, cât și al dezvoltării asistate de IA este aceeași: că sistemul „funcționează pur și simplu”. 747 ne-a învățat că sistemele complexe necesită supraveghere umană disciplinată, protocoale de comunicare structurate și o cultură care tratează fiecare element din lista de verificare ca nenegociabil. Agenții de codificare nu cer nimic mai puțin.

Pentru echipele care se construiesc pe platforme precum Mewayz — unde o singură modificare a codului poate afecta fluxurile de lucru CRM, procesarea plăților, motoarele de programare și portalurile orientate către clienți — această disciplină nu este opțională. Menținem documentația detaliată a modulelor și hărțile de integrare în mod specific, astfel încât atât dezvoltatorii umani, cât și agenții AI să poată înțelege raza de explozie a oricărei modificări date. Este lista noastră de verificare înainte de zbor și a prevenit mai multe incidente de producție decât orice suită de teste.

Efectul democratizării

Înainte de 747, călătoriile aeriene transatlantice erau un lux rezervat celor bogați. Primul zbor 747 al Pan Am de la New York la Londra, în ianuarie 1970, nu a transportat doar mai mulți pasageri, ci a schimbat fundamental cine putea zbura. În decurs de un deceniu, călătoriile cu avionul au trecut de la o experiență de elită la o așteptare a clasei de mijloc. 747 nu a făcut zborul mai ieftin din întâmplare. Amploarea sa mare – 374 de pasageri într-o configurație tipică față de 150 pe un 707 – a condus economia pe loc care a transformat industria.

💡 DID YOU KNOW?

Mewayz replaces 8+ business tools in one platform

CRM · Invoicing · HR · Projects · Booking · eCommerce · POS · Analytics. Free forever plan available.

Start Free →

Agenții de codare produc același efect de democratizare în dezvoltarea de software. Sarcinile care odată necesitau un dezvoltator senior full-stack, două săptămâni și un buget semnificativ pot fi acum îndeplinite de un manager de produs cu cerințe clare și un agent AI într-o după-amiază. Acest lucru nu este ipotetic. Startup-urile trimit MVP-uri în câteva zile. Fondatorii Solo construiesc produse care ar fi necesitat echipe de cinci persoane în urmă cu trei ani. Experții din domeniul non-tehnic creează instrumente interne care le rezolvă de fapt problemele, în loc să aștepte 18 luni într-un backlog IT.

Aceasta este tocmai filosofia din spatele abordării lui Mewayz. Platforma noastră a fost creată pentru a oferi întreprinderilor mici și mijlocii acces la aceleași instrumente operaționale pe care companiile Fortune 500 le consideră de la sine înțelese — CRM, salarizare, facturare, managementul flotei, analize, sisteme de rezervare — fără eticheta de preț pentru întreprindere sau termenul de implementare de șase luni. Când combinați o platformă modulară precum Mewayz cu instrumente de dezvoltare bazate pe inteligență artificială, obțineți ceva cu adevărat nou: companii care își pot personaliza, extinde și automatiza operațiunile la o viteză și un cost de neimaginat în urmă cu cinci ani.

Moduri de eșec și cutii negre

Fiecare 747 poartă un înregistrator de date de zbor și un înregistrator de voce în cabina de pilotaj – celebrele „cutii negre”. Ele există pentru că industria aviației a învățat, adesea prin tragedie, că înțelegerea eșecului este mai importantă decât prevenirea acestuia. Nu puteți preveni fiecare defecțiune într-un sistem cu șase milioane de piese. Dar puteți construi o cultură și o infrastructură care să vă asigure că fiecare eșec vă învață ceva.

Agenții de codare au o problemă cu cutia neagră. Când un agent produce o eroare subtilă - o condiție de cursă, o vulnerabilitate de securitate, o eroare de logică care se manifestă numai în anumite condiții de date - poate fi extraordinar de dificil de înțeles de ce. Agentul nu are un „proces de gândire” pe care îl puteți reda în același mod în care puteți reda o înregistrare vocală în cabina de pilotaj. Această opacitate este una dintre cele mai importante provocări cu care se confruntă astăzi dezvoltarea asistată de AI, iar industria nu a rezolvat-o încă.

Cele mai eficiente strategii de atenuare reflectă abordarea aviației:

  • Sisteme de examinare stratificată: la fel cum zborurile comerciale necesită atât un căpitan, cât și un prim-ofițer pentru a verifica încrucișați acțiunile critice, codul generat de agent ar trebui să treacă prin testare automată, analiză statică și revizuire umană înainte de a ajunge la producție.
  • Reținerea razei de explozie: aviația folosește sisteme redundante, astfel încât nicio defecțiune nu este catastrofală. În mod similar, bazele de cod bine arhitecturate izolează modulele, astfel încât greșeala unui agent într-o zonă să nu se extindă în întregul sistem.
  • Retrospective ale incidentelor: „cultura justă” a industriei aviației – în care raportarea erorilor este încurajată, nu pedepsită – ar trebui adoptată pentru dezvoltarea asistată de IA. Când un agent produce o eroare, întrebarea nu este „cine a aprobat asta?” dar „ce context a lipsit?”
  • Monitorizare continuă: aeronavele moderne transmit date de telemetrie în timp real. Software-ul de producție construit cu asistență AI are nevoie de o observabilitate la fel de riguroasă - înregistrare, alerte și detectarea anomaliilor care detectează problemele înainte ca utilizatorii să o facă.

Sfârșitul liniei — și începutul

Boeing și-a livrat ultimul 747 în ianuarie 2023, încheind o serie de producție care a durat 54 de ani și 1.574 de avioane. Avionul jumbo nu a murit pentru că a eșuat. A murit pentru că lumea pe care a creat-o - o lume a călătoriilor aeriene accesibile, fiabile și pe distanțe lungi - a evoluat dincolo de nevoia unui corp lat cu patru motoare. Avioanele mai eficiente cu două motoare, cum ar fi 787 și A350, fac acum treaba cu costuri de operare mai mici și o economie mai bună de combustibil. 747 a fost victima propriului succes.

Agenții de codare vor urma un arc similar. Instrumentele pe care le folosim astăzi – bazate pe prompt, pe chat, care necesită îndrumare umană semnificativă – sunt 747-urile dezvoltării asistate de AI. Sunt revoluționari, imperfecți și absolut transformatori. Dar ele vor fi în cele din urmă înlocuite de sisteme mai rafinate, mai eficiente și mai autonome pe care abia le putem imagina astăzi. Dezvoltatorii și afacerile care prosperă nu vor fi cei care au rezistat schimbării sau cei care au avut încredere orbește în automatizare. Ei vor fi cei care au învățat să lucreze cu mașina — care au înțeles că adevărata inovație nu a fost niciodată aeronava sau agentul, ci sistemul de oameni și tehnologie care lucrează împreună.

Pentru cele 138.000 de companii care se bazează deja pe Mewayz, acest viitor nu este abstract. Este realitatea zilnică a utilizării automatizării inteligente pentru a rula operațiuni, a servi clienții și a crește - un modul, un flux de lucru, un agent bine solicitat la un moment dat. 747 a dovedit că ingineria îndrăzneață, combinată cu operațiuni disciplinate, ar putea schimba lumea. Agenții de codificare o dovedesc din nou.

Întrebări frecvente

Ce sunt agenții de codificare și cum se leagă aceștia cu analogia 747?

Agenții de codare sunt sisteme AI autonome care pot scrie, depana și implementa software cu o supraveghere umană minimă. La fel ca Boeing 747 – care a asamblat șase milioane de piese într-o mașină de încredere – agenții de codificare orchestrează baze de cod complexe prin descompunerea proiectelor masive în componente gestionabile. Ambele reprezintă puncte de inflexiune în care complexitatea ingineriei a cerut abordări complet noi ale proiectării, testării și asigurării calității.

Pot agenții de codare să înlocuiască pe deplin dezvoltatorii de software umani?

Nu încă și probabil nu în totalitate. Așa cum 747 încă necesită piloți experimentați, în ciuda automatizării extinse, agenții de codificare funcționează cel mai bine atunci când sunt ghidați de dezvoltatori calificați care oferă direcție arhitecturală și rezultate de revizuire. Valoarea reală constă în creșterea capacității umane - gestionarea sarcinilor repetitive, generarea de boilerplate și accelerarea ciclurilor de iterație, astfel încât inginerii să se poată concentra pe soluționarea creativă a problemelor și pe decizii strategice.

Cum beneficiază companiile astăzi de instrumentele de automatizare bazate pe inteligență artificială?

Afacerile câștigă eficiență prin descărcarea fluxurilor de lucru repetitive către sistemele AI. Platforme precum Mewayz demonstrează acest lucru cu un sistem de operare de afaceri cu 207 module, care începe de la 19 USD/lună, care automatizează totul, de la marketing la operațiuni. În mod similar, agenții de codificare reduc timpul și costurile de dezvoltare, permițând echipelor să livreze caracteristici mai rapid, menținând în același timp calitatea, la fel ca modul în care 747 a democratizat călătoriile aeriene internaționale.

Ce lecții din siguranța aviației se aplică fiabilității codificării AI?

Abordarea riguroasă a aviației în ceea ce privește redundanța, testarea și evaluarea incidentelor informează direct dezvoltarea responsabilă a IA. 747 și-a câștigat recordul de siguranță prin mii de defecțiuni simulate și sisteme de rezervă stratificate. Agenții de codificare trebuie să adopte principii similare — testare automată, puncte de control uman în buclă și monitorizare continuă — pentru a se asigura că codul pe care îl produc respectă standardele de fiabilitate de nivel de producție înainte de implementare.

Try Mewayz Free

All-in-one platform for CRM, invoicing, projects, HR & more. No credit card required.

Start managing your business smarter today

Join 30,000+ businesses. Free forever plan · No credit card required.

Ready to put this into practice?

Join 30,000+ businesses using Mewayz. Free forever plan — no credit card required.

Start Free Trial →

Ready to take action?

Start your free Mewayz trial today

All-in-one business platform. No credit card required.

Start Free →

14-day free trial · No credit card · Cancel anytime